Figure 1 shows the geometry and dimensions of the column specimens. The cross section of prototype and model are 2.0 × 1.5 m and 0.5 × 0.36 m, respectively. The corresponding wall thickness is 400 mm and 120 mm, respectively. The height of the column (i.e., the distance from the horizontal actuator loading point to the top of the RC footing) of prototype and model are 5.8 m and 1.44 m, respectively. The properties of the specimens are listed in Table 1. In order to compare the seismic performance of hollow RC rectangular bridge columns subjected to uniaxial bending and biaxial bending, the reversed cyclic tests of two identical specimens were conducted under uniaxial bending with axial load and biaxial bending with axial load. Note that the uniaxial bending load was imposed in the weak axis of specimen S1 and in the strong axis of specimen S2. Two model columns S3 and S4, which were identical to S1 and S2, respectively were tested under biaxial bending.
